I tried to add images to my blog-post through the ‘insert/edit image’ option and gave the link to one of my images in Flickr. The image didn’t show up. Instead a ‘image not found’ logo appeared.
Images are working fine if I upload the image and blog it through ‘send to editor’ option.
It is also working fine when I insert the images through ‘blog this’ option in Flickr.
Help!
-
Which Flickr address are you using? You need to use the full link to the image; you get that by clicking All Sizes on your photo at Flickr and copying the full link. Is that what you’re doing?

One more query,
Flickr asks the user to provide a link back in case we use the pictures in external websites.
What do I do? -
Once you’ve inserted the image, select it and click the insert link icon in your toolbar (it looks like a pair of chains). Put the link back to the Flick photo page there (the original link you were using). That should be all you need to do, according to their guidelines.
